Transaction 28fb40fc89e195e67df998b104cc6f774ee1895f63138d25cb15e8229b61b94a
1 Input
1 Output
-
28fb40fc89e195e67df998b104cc6f774ee1895f63138d25cb15e8229b61b94a:0
- value
- 27878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f43d4515da78fe9d8a277b8e48304ea192e0e02 OP_EQUAL
- address
- 3K8LF3si9FJEDbz7cLBVH3FQodp52BCwFQ